Required Skills

Java Scala

Work Authorization

  • US Citizen

  • Green Card

  • EAD (OPT/CPT/GC/H4)

  • H1B Work Permit

Preferred Employment

  • Corp-Corp

  • W2-Permanent

  • W2-Contract

  • Contract to Hire

Employment Type

  • Consulting/Contract

education qualification

  • UG :- - Not Required

  • PG :- - Not Required

Other Information

  • No of position :- ( 1 )

  • Post :- 1st Mar 2024

JOB DETAIL

As a Scala Engineer, you will • Design and develop applications using Scala technology • Hands on working experience with Scala • Knowledge of tools and frameworks used in the Scala ecosystem, such as Akka, Play, or Slick • Ability to design and implement backend applications • Knowledge of relational databases, preferably PostgreSQL • Experience in Apache Hive, Apache Spark, Apache Kafka. • Learn our business domain and technology infrastructure quickly and share your knowledge freely and actively with others in the team. • Mentor junior engineers on the team • Lead daily standups and design reviews • Groom and prioritize backlog using JIRA • Act as the point of contact for your assigned business domain Requirements: • Minimum 12 + years of IT experience. • 5+ years of hands-on experience developing Scala applications • Experience with programming languages: Python, Java, etc. • Experience with scripting languages: Perl, Shell, etc. • Practice working with, processing, and managing large data sets (multi TB/PB scale). • Exposure to test driven development and automated testing frameworks. • Background in Scrum/Agile development methodologies. • Capable of delivering on multiple competing priorities with little supervision. • Excellent verbal and written communication skills. • Bachelor's Degree in computer science or equivalent experience. The most successful candidates will also have experience in the following: • Gitflow • Atlassian products – BitBucket, JIRA, Confluence etc. • Continuous Integration tools such as Bamboo, Jenkins, or TFS.

Company Information